How To Conserve Money On Kitchen Remodeling in Sunland-Tujunga

The very first tip is easy: Start with a strategy. The last thing you want to do is set up beautiful brand-new counters and after that recognize that you need to remove them to install a farmhouse sink. It’s alright if some tasks take some time, but make certain they all line up – this way, when one task takes more than expected or fails, it doesn’t mess up the next action.

 

Updating your kitchen does not have to be a considerable investment. Here are some practical ways that you can upgrade without breaking the bank:

Paint cabinet. Installing brand-new cabinets might be more pricey than painting cabinets, but it will offer your area an entirely different look. Giving old cabinet deals with an update is also less pricey and time-consuming than changing the whole set of boxes or spending thousands on brand new ones.

New backsplash. A new tile backsplash can bring a cooking area color combination and make your space look more modern and upgraded. It normally only costs around $300 in products to get going though you might have some leftover tiles from the initial setup of your flooring or previous house renovations. Labor is pricier than that, but it’s still less expensive if you do it yourself!

Paint your kitchen appliance. If your kitchen appliances are still in good shape, but the colors are dated, you can get them painted at a local body shop. The paint job will cost around $100 for all of your existing home appliances, and with this deal, it’s easy to see why going without is not an option!

Consider your floor covering alternative. Vinyl floor covering is now a popular option for houses and businesses that don’t want to invest money on high-end products like hardwood, slate, or marble. You can discover designs in all cost varieties, from budget plan vinyl tiles with basic designs to high-end vinyl sheets made from actual wood veneer!

How Kitchen Remodeling in Sunland-Tujunga Affect Your House Worth

 

A current research study found that 80% of buyers place the kitchen among their three most important spaces. This is not a surprise, considering how much individuals enjoy updating kitchens with high-end surfaces and thoughtful upgrades, which can increase your property’s value by a tremendous 20%.

 

A minor update in an outdated space like the kitchen might be all you need to draw in more purchasers searching for something brand-new.

 

It appears as if home appliances and granite countertops are important to the new house buying process. According to a current survey, 69% of purchasers would have paid more for these features, while 55% said they believed that they would pay additional for this upgrade in their next purchase.
